Transaction 596ca53b0ade77753c5bf4ccb006d44ec0a2e8cc8e490ac417489a079bed5573

3 Input
2 Outputs
  • 596ca53b0ade77753c5bf4ccb006d44ec0a2e8cc8e490ac417489a079bed5573:0
  • value  7457280
    address  3BXFwmb3ofG8EhSaXgdQ6ujGrCG9NovkAY
  • 596ca53b0ade77753c5bf4ccb006d44ec0a2e8cc8e490ac417489a079bed5573:1
  • value  505280
    address  3LC3fHTAcWMmGBNvkDvw9srY5uYuDfLAbV